繁体   English   中英

Citymaps SDK的CEMarker类的fadeTime代表什么?

[英]What does the fadeTime for the Citymaps SDK's CEMarker class represent?

文档仅声明以下内容:

/** How long it takes the marker to fade in and out when visibility changes. */
@property (nonatomic, assign) CGFloat fadeTime;

这个CGFloat值代表秒吗? 毫秒? 无论我提供什么价值:

[marker setFadeTime:3000.0f]; // assume milliseconds

要么

marker.fadeTime = 3.0f;       // assume seconds

它似乎并没有改变行为。 任何帮助表示赞赏。

(抱歉-信誉点不足,无法创建citymaps标签-超过1500个成员,请随时提供帮助!)

谢谢

我是Citymaps的开发人员。 感谢您提供我们相当裸露的文档。 查看文档使我意识到,我们在iOS和android(哎呀)上都缺少标记的一些关键属性。

为了回答您的问题,fadeTime会根据其可见性的变化来调整标记淡入或淡出的速度。 目前,只能通过CEMarkerGroup的碰撞检测功能来更改可见性。 我提到的那些缺少的属性之一是iOS的“隐藏”属性,或Android的“可见性”属性,类似于它们各自的View类。

我已经对文档进行了一些更新,以回答此值是什么单位的问题。 我们尝试遵循平台的惯例。 对于iOS,此值以秒为单位。 在Android上,此值以毫秒为单位。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M